    Abstract : The research presented in this thesis has been focused on the study of thin Ag films, grown on metal-reconstructed Si(111) and Ge(111) surfaces.The films have been grown at room temperature, and the morphologiesand electronic structures of the films have been investigated using scanning tunneling microscopy and spectroscopy (STM/STS), low-energy electron diffraction (LEED) and angle-resolved photoelectron spectroscopy(ARPES).
